Journalling pages

Daily journal page

The daily page consists of two parts. You have the first page you fill out in the morning and the second part in the evening.

Start your day by describing how you feel. You can draw an emoji or describe it in 2–3 sentences. Then, to steer your day in a positive direction, write down why today will be a great day.

What’s important to you and what is something that always makes you smile? These are three simple questions to answer that will have a huge positive impact on your day.

To focus on positive vibes, even more, write down 2-3 affirmations for today.


example of a daily journal page

What are affirmations?

It’s a phrase or mantra that you repeat to yourself, which describes a specific outcome or who you want to be. They are simple messages repeated over and over, so they slowly change your thinking which leads to changing your reality.

Tips for writing affirmations:

  1. Use “I” and “My”, it’s all about you.

  2. Stay positive. Don’t focus on the things you want to avoid or get rid of. Instead, focus on the positive side of behaviors.

  3. Avoid “want” and “need”. Good alternatives are: “I choose”, “I embrace”, and “I have”.

  4. Keep it in the present tense

  5. Believe yourself

In the evening, review your day and write down three things you are grateful for. The great thing is that it’s an easy habit to form, and after a while, you are left with a great collection of inspiring material to look back on when you need a pick-me-up.

Writing down your thoughts about…

  1. What you are thankful for

  2. What can make you more optimistic? – because you are choosing to see more of the positivity in your life and give less power to negative emotions. It also means that you are acknowledging the goodness in your life which leads to feeling more positive emotions, relishing good experiences, and building strong relationships.

The perfect recipe for a much happier life.

Also, to feel better about yourself at the end of the day, answer these questions: What did you learn today? What made you proud, and excited, and what inspired you?

Benefits of evening journaling:

  1. It allows you to debrief your day

  2. It relaxes you and clears your mind

  3. It helps to transition from a hectic day into sleep
